AN ORDINANCE OF THE CITY COUNCIL OF THE CITY OF THE COLONY, TEXAS, PROVIDING FOR THE ESTABLISHMENT OF "THE COLONY MUNICIPAL STORM WATER UTILITY SYSTEM"; MAKING CERTAIN FINDINGS AND RECITALS IN REGARD TO SAID SYSTEM; AND ENACTING PROVISIONS INCIDENT AND RELATING TO THE SUBJECT AND PURPOSES OF THIS ORDINANCE; PROVIDING A REPEALING CLAUSE; PROVIDING A SEVERABILITY CLAUSE; AND PROVIDING AN EFFECTIVE DATE. WHEREAS, pursuant to Subchapter C of Chapter 402 of the Local Government Code known as the Municipal Drainage Utility Systems Act (the "Act"), the City Council of the City of The Colony, Texas (the "City"), is authorized and empowered to adopt the Act; and WHEREAS, the Act requires that the City, through its governing body, must find that the City will (i) establish a schedule of drainage charges against all real property in the municipality subject to the charges under the Act; (ii) provide drainage for all real property in the City on payment of drainage charges, except real property exempted under state law, and (iii) offer drainage and on nondiscriminatory, reasonable, and equitable terms; and WHEREAS, the Act requires that prior to enacting the ordinance adopting the provisions of the Act, the governing body must publish a notice in a newspaper of general circulation in the City stating the time and place of a public hearing to consider the proposed ordinance; and WHEREAS, the City has satisfied the procedural requirements established by the Act as condition precedent to the adoption of this ordinance; and WHEREAS, the City has found and determined and does hereby find and determine that it is appropriate to adopt the act and to establish a municipal storm water utility system as provided in the Act; and WHEREAS, the City has further found and determined and does hereby further find and determine the drainage of the City to be a public utility within the meaning of the Act. NOW, THEREFORE, BE IT ORDAINED BY THE CITY COUNCIL OF THE CITY OF THE COLONY, TEXAS; P~el SECTION 1. That the preambles of this ordinance set forth above are hereby incorporated by reference as if fully set forth herein and are true and correct findings and determinations of the City. SECTION 2. That the Act is hereby adopted and shall be fully implemented as provided by the Act and by the City Council, and the drainage of the City is hereby found to be a public utility within the meaning of the Act. SECTION 3. That the City will provide drainage and storm water management for all real property within its boundaries which is established as the service area of the system, upon payment of the determined drainage charges, as defined in the Act, and excluding certain exempted real property; and, the fees, assessments, and charges will be based on non-discriminatory, reasonable, and equitable terms. SECTION 4. That the City is hereby authorized to bill the drainage charges incurred as a result of the adoption of the Act and establishment of the municipal storm water utility system thereunder with its other public utility billings, the drainage charge to be separately identified. SECTION 5. That upon passage of this ordinance, the City may levy a schedule of storm water fees upon satisfaction of the procedural requirements provided in the Act. SECTION 6. Existing drainage facilities, materials and supplies of the City are hereby incorporated into the storm water utility system. SECTION 7. That the City is authorized to exempt certain entities or persons from all ordinances, resolutions and rules which the City may adopt from time to time in connection with the adoption of the Act and the establishment of its municipal utility drainage system.
